How do I permanently disconnect a hardwired smoke detector?

How do I permanently disconnect a hardwired smoke detector?

The steps are pretty simple:

  • Turn off the power.
  • Give your smoke alarm a twist to loosen it.
  • Disconnect your smoke alarm from the wiring harness.
  • Loosen the screws that hold the mounting bracket in place.
  • Remove the mounting bracket.
  • Disconnect the old wiring harness from the existing wires.

  • How do I stop a hardwired smoke detector from beeping?

    Resetting the Alarm

  • Turn off the power to the smoke alarm at the circuit breaker.
  • Remove the smoke alarm from the mounting bracket and disconnect the power.
  • Remove the battery.
  • Press and hold the test button for at least 15 seconds.
  • Reconnect the power and reinstall the battery.

    What happens if you take the battery out of a hardwired smoke detector?

    Hardwired alarms often have a battery backup just in case the electrical power goes out. If you take the battery out of one of these units and your power goes out, the alarm will fail to sound and warn you of the danger

  • How do you get a hard-wired smoke detector to stop chirping?

    Wired Alarms

  • Shut off your home’s main power breaker.
  • Disconnect the alarm unit’s power cable.
  • Take the alarm down.
  • Take out the backup battery.
  • Hold the test button for 15 seconds to drain any residual charge.
  • Re-install or replace the backup battery.
  • Reconnect the alarm to the power cable.
  • Replace the alarm.
